"Yang Zhi Yu" - The Suet Jade gaiwan has slightly thicker walls than the other, general quality, version , so it is slightly heavier. Yet, it is very comfortable and also suitable teaware for beginners for it's small diameter ( easy to hold ) and durability ( thicker walls not easy to chip off ) , or even as daily use teaware for advanced tea drinkers.
